Abstract

1427400 Fluid-pressure servomotor systems MINE SAFETY APPLIANCES CO 26 July 1973 [25 Oct 1972] 35690/73 Heading G3P [Also in Divisions A5 and F2] Breathing apparatus Fig. I, (not shown) wherein gas is normally provided to a facepiece (2) from a compressed gas source (1) via a conduit (4), pressure reducing valve (3), conduit (6), control valve 7, conduit (8), and demand valve (9), is arranged such that an emergency loss of pressure at the gas source 1 communicates via conduit (12) to close valve 7 and the user inhales through an alarm valve 30 which provides a pulse of gas when the gas pressure falls below the predetermined value to signal the user that the control valve has closed. The control valve, Fig. 2, includes a port 17 and seat 18 between the inlet and outlet 26 of the valve, a closure member 22 and closure spring 23, the supply pressure (1) actuating a piston 13 connected with said closure member 22 the spring force being adjustable to alter the critical pressure valve of the supply gas. A stem 15 fixed to the piston 13 and closure member 22 extends through the port 17 and is enclosed by spring 23 which is compressed between the closure member and a collar 24 threaded on to the stem. The alarm valve 30, Fig. 3, includes a valve seat and a valve outlet 36, a diaphragm 37 therebetween and held against the seat by the predetermined gas pressure, a check valve 51 and a seat 53 normally engaging with a flexible valve disc 54 and stem 55 plugged into the check-valve bore 52. Compressed between the front flange 43 of sleeve 42 and the rear wall of the chamber is a coil spring 56 urging sleeve and metal disc 39 to close the valve. When gas pressure falls below the critical value, control valve 7 closes, and inhalation reduces, the pressure in conduits (8) and (32) causing support diaphragm 37 and disc 39 to move rearwardly against the coil spring 56, moving check-valve seat 53, allowing the gas pressure behind diaphragm 45 to drop and admit gas from inlet 35 to the outlet 36.
